Job description

We are seeking a dedicated and client-focused Technical Analyst for an enterprise-level contract opportunity based in Toronto. In this role, you will take on a key application support and site administration capacity, specializing in the rollout, ongoing operation, and stabilization of enterprise Microsoft 365 and SharePoint document management solutions.

As a principal technical analyst, you will bridge the gap between business end-users, project rollout leads, and technical engineering teams. Operating within a fast-paced environment, you will lead tiered incident triage, resolve user issues through ServiceNow ticket management, perform root-cause analysis, and enforce document governance baselines. This position is ideal for an experienced support analyst who can deliver targeted user guidance, author knowledge base documentation, and drive continuous service improvements across enterprise collaboration platforms.

Location: Toronto, ON

Assignment Type: Hybrid / Onsite

Contract Duration: 6-month contract (with potential 2-month extension)

Advantages
Enterprise M365 & SharePoint Scope: Deliver end-to-end support, permissions management, and administration for modern SharePoint Online sites and document repositories.

Service Delivery Modernization: Manage incident triage, root-cause analyses, and ticket resolution workflows using industry-leading ITSM tools (ServiceNow).

Rollout & Stabilization Leadership: Play a hands-on role supporting organization-wide platform implementations, user onboarding, post-migration issue resolution, and steady-state transitions.

Focus on Client Satisfaction: Develop user training, author knowledge base documentation, and analyze service metrics to promote solution adoption and continuous improvement.

Responsibilities
Provide tiered application support for the enterprise M365 and SharePoint environment, including incident triage, root-cause issue analysis, and resolution.

Manage, track, and document user-reported support tickets through ServiceNow, ensuring timely closure in accordance with service level agreements.

Perform day-to-day administration for SharePoint sites, managing user access permissions, group inheritances, site configurations, and document library content structures.

Advise end-users on SharePoint site usage, document management best practices, and organizational governance standards.

Support enterprise-wide platform implementation and rollout activities, assisting with user onboarding, post-deployment stabilization, and post-migration fix validations.

Perform root-cause analysis on complex incidents and coordinate technical escalations with specialized engineering squads as required.

Collaborate with project and technical teams to identify adoption challenges, evaluate support risks, and mitigate user pain points.

Author, maintain, and update technical support documentation, standard operating procedures, and self-service knowledge base articles.

Deliver targeted user guidance and support sessions to promote platform adoption and effective tool utilization.

Track support metrics, identify recurring incident trends, and present recommendations to leadership for continuous service enhancements.

Qualifications
Core Requirements & Support Experience
Education: University degree or Community College diploma in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related technical discipline (or equivalent professional experience).

Application Support Tenure: Minimum 3 to 5 years of experience providing application support within an enterprise environment.

M365 & SharePoint Online Expertise: Demonstrated hands-on experience supporting Microsoft 365 and SharePoint Online, including user support, site configuration, permissions management, and issue resolution.

ITSM & Ticket Management: Hands-on experience utilizing enterprise ITSM tools (such as ServiceNow) for ticket tracking, documentation, and service delivery.

Migration & Rollout Support: Proven experience supporting platform migrations, enterprise deployments, user onboarding, and post-implementation environment stabilization.

Soft Skills & Client Engagement
Consultative Communication: Exceptional written and verbal communication skills with the ability to explain complex technical concepts clearly to non-technical users.

Client Engagement & Service Quality: Strong client-facing orientation with a focus on service quality, responsiveness, client satisfaction, and continuous process improvement.

Organization & Collaboration: Strong organizational and multi-tasking abilities to manage competing priorities independently and collaboratively within cross-functional teams.
